## Service Accounts — Socketry Compression

Plugin service accounts on the Brindlewick gateway may enable permessage-deflate. Tradeoff: ~30% bandwidth savings vs. higher CPU and memory per connection. Accounts pushing >500 msgs/sec should disable compression. Each plugin gets one service account scoped to its channel namespace. Register via the Brindlewick console, then authenticate your socket handshake with the key that follows.

API key for yahig-tadup: kto7_ubizbYm

Action item: The Relayn deploy-status bot silently dropped updates when the pipeline API paginated results, so responders believed a rollback had completed when it had not. We will add pagination handling, a staleness banner, and an integration test. Until merged, verify deploy state directly in the pipeline console, documented at the page below.

runbook for kahop-kajop: https://rundeck.ordinio.test/display/secrets/pipeline/issue/pages/repo/browse/e5732776e07d1285107e5aeb

Subject: ORM cut-over complete

Welcome aboard. Over the weekend we cut the Bramblehold inventory service over from the legacy Quillbase ORM to the new repository layer. Reads and writes now go through the adapter; the old mapping files are frozen and slated for deletion next sprint. If you need to run the service locally, use the configuration below.

config for yajep-tafof:
[rusath]
team = julmir
access_code = ac_fe37fd
host = rusath.novactech.test
port = 8000
owner = pelmir.weneth
peer = oliwyn.olvarqdyn.internal

## Ownership

The clock-skew monitor for the Quarrylight build farm lives in this repo. Build agents occasionally drift more than the 250ms tolerance, which breaks artifact timestamp ordering and causes the Slatebird scheduler to mark runs as flaky. If support sees skew alerts, first check the NTP sidecar logs, then escalate rather than restarting agents manually — restarts mask the drift without fixing it. Questions about the monitor, its thresholds, or the escalation path go to the component owner listed below.

account owner for kagag-yahap: Novath Quenok